Nutrition and Meals

Meals and Snacks

Breakfast and an afternoon snack will be provided without charge for children who are in attendance that day.  A hot lunch will be available for all children present during the lunch hour. Lunch tickets may be purchased depending on Income Eligibility Form qualifications. All children enrolled in the Children’s Center program are required to fill out the CACFP IEF for childcare form. 

Parents of infants are asked to provide specialized formula or breast milk for their child. The Children’s Center and CACFP will supply Parent’s Choice formula/Soy formula. When the infant is ready the Children’s Center will supply baby food, cereal, and snacks.

The Children’s Center participates in CACFP, a USDA-funded program and is an equal opportunity provider and employer.
